The tundra-style tire has been independently invented at different times and places. In North America its post-World War II invention is credited to Canadian Welland Phipps, [1] potentially inspired by the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company's pre-World War II development of their own, similar low-pressure "airwheel" as a complete wheel-rim and tire set — said to be of the "Musselman" type from U ...
The 1922 London Motor Show displayed a range of tread patterns that were reported on by The Autocar. [2] Some of these, from Miller and the French firm of Bergougnan [ fr ] , display what would now be recognised as the classic bar grip pattern of sharp-edged transverse bars with a wide central rib.

The first drag racing slick was developed by M&H Tires (Marvin & Harry Tires) in the early 1950s. It was the only company in the world that produced and sold original drag racing tyres. Drag racing slicks vary in size, from slicks used on motorcycles to very wide ones used on "top fuel" dragsters.
